Malaysia’s steel prices fell 0.4-6% in August

Malaysia’s steel prices recorded a month-on-month decrease of between 0.6% and 4% in August, Kallanish notes. The Department of Statistics Malaysia (DOSM) says in a statement that the price index per unit of steel and metal sections also recorded a decrease of between 0.3% and 2%.
